Differences between 99 and 98 E300 D
 
Were there any differences between these two model years other than including leather as a standard feature?

ohcaptainron 05-10-2005 06:00 PM

Yea, the 99 has leather seat inserts full leather was an option, 98 could be had with leather or tex, the 99 had a digital data bus area network, all audio etc played thru, and the 99 had head protection curtians, other than that same car.
